PROBLEM

Fields do not display in an attribute table despite being turned on in Layer Properties

Last Published: April 26, 2020

Description

Data in an attribute table can be displayed and organized to suit the needs of a user's current analysis. The visibility of the fields can be set by clicking Turn All Fields On, Turn All Fields Off, or checking the boxes next to the field's name in the Layer Properties dialog box.
[O-Image]
In some instances, when all fields are checked in the Layer Properties dialog box, some fields are not displayed in the attribute table.

Cause

This issue may occur due to the following reasons:

• The field column width is too small, causing the field to be invisible.
• The table has been edited multiple times.
• The map document is corrupt.
• The Normal.gxt file is corrupt.

Solution or Workaround

Use one of the following options to resolve this issue.

Option A

Restore the default column widths.
1. Right-click the layer > Open Attribute Table.
2. Click Table Options > Restore Default Column Widths.
[O-Image]

Option B

Remove the layer from the map document, and add the same layer back to the map.

Option C

Note:
Close all Esri applications running on the system before proceeding to the option below.

Rename the Normal.gxt file to Normal_old.gxt. The file is located at:

C:\Users\<username>\AppData\Roaming\ESRI\Desktop10.x\ArcCatalog


Note:
Enable 'Show Hidden Files and Folders' if unable to locate the application data folder.
[O-Image]

Article ID:000012419

Software:
  • ArcMap

Get help from ArcGIS experts

Contact technical support

Download the Esri Support App

Go to download options

Related Information

Discover more on this topic